INTEGRATED MANAGEMENT OF SOYBEAN PESTS: EFFECT OF INSECTICIDES ON NATURAL ENEMIES

ABSTRACT

This research aimed to evaluate the effect of the insecticides Actara Mix 330 CE and Curyom 550 CE on some natural enemies found in soybean crop. The insecticides Actara Mix (200 mL /ha), Actara Mix (200 mL /ha) + sodium cloride (0.5%), Actara Mix (100 mL /ha) + Curyom (150 mL) and Curyom (150 mL) were tested under field conditions. Thiodan (500 mL) + salt was used as control. Evaluations were made before the applications and 2, 7, and 15 days after. In laboratory conditions, the compatibility of Nomurae riley, Beauveria bassiana and Bacillus thuringiensis with the insecticides Actara Mix, Curyon and Thiodan was studied. The parameters evaluated were vegetative growth, production and conidia viability for the fungi, and colony forming units for the bacteria. The insecticides did not effect the colonization of Anticarsia gemmatalis and Cerotoma sp. by the fungi N. rileyi and B. bassiana, respectively. Some effect was observed on spiders and egg parasites in the first week after the application. Meanwhile, the mortality of the natural enemies did not surpass 50%, except for Thiodan (62%). In the laboratory, Actara Mix did not effect the growth of the fungi. Curyon and Thiodan reduced the spores production of B. basiana and completely inhibited the formation of B. thuringiensis colonies. Curyon reduced the conidia germination of N. rileyi.
